There was news a few weeks back that YouTube was getting out of the original scripted series business and had no interest in keeping Cobra Kai after season 3. Sony is shopping the show around and the top contenders are Netflix and Hulu. A deal with one appears to be close but obviously a lot of negotiations are involved.
This means sometime soon Cobra Kai will leave YouTube Premium for the new platform. The show’s third season will debut on that platform most likely “By the end of Summer.”
